Pet Care 101: Essential Tips for Happy Hounds and Felines

Welcoming a furry friend into your family is a joy overflowing with love and companionship. Yet, providing proper care for these adorable creatures needs attention and dedication to ensure they thrive.

Here are some essential tips to keep your hounds and cats happy and well:

* **Food:** Choose a balanced diet appropriate for your pet's age, breed, and activity level.

* **Hydration:** Always provide fresh, clean water for your furry companion.

* **Playtime:** Regular exercise is crucial for your pet's physical and mental well-being.

* **Veterinary Checkups:** Schedule regular visits with a veterinarian to track your pet's health and address any potential issues early on.

* **Enrichment:** Provide plenty of toys, puzzles, and interactive activities to keep your pet engaged.

* **Affection:** Shower your furry friend with love, affection, and attention. This strengthens a strong relationship between you and your pet.

Golden Years: Loving Your Aging Pet

As our furry companions grow older, their needs change. They may demand more gentle care and consideration. Providing a loving environment for your senior pet can significantly improve their quality of life.

It's important to monitor carefully any indications of seniority. Common changes in senior pets can include joint stiffness, slowed movement, and cognitive decline .

To ensure your senior pet with the best possible care, think about these tips:

  • Offer a comfortable and safe sleeping area.
  • Adjust their diet as they age.
  • Carefully examine their teeth and gums for any issues.
  • Take them to the vet frequently to track their well-being.

By giving your senior pet with the love, care, and attention they need, you can help them enjoy their golden years to the fullest.

Traveling with Your Furry Companion: Tips and Tricks

Planning a trip with your companion animal? It can be an exciting adventure! But before you hit the road, there are a few things to keep in mind to ensure a smooth and enjoyable getaway for both you and your pal.

First, make sure your furry buddy is properly vaccinated. This will help keep them safe from potential illnesses while you're away from home.

Next, consider packing some essential items for your furry friend. This could include their meals, water, leash, and a few of their favorite toys.

Finally, don't forget to plan ahead for your companion animal's stay. Many resorts are now pet-friendly, but it's always best to verify before you go.

Making a Pet-Friendly Home: Comfort and Safety First

Welcoming a furry family member into your house is an incredibly rewarding experience. To ensure both their happiness and safety, it's essential to transform your space into a pet-friendly haven. Start by evaluating potential hazards and taking out anything that could be harmful if ingested or tripped over.

  • Set up a designated sleeping area with a comfortable bed. This will give your pet a sense of security and a place to de-stress.
  • Purchase in sturdy and safe toys that are appropriate for your animal's size and breed. Rotate toys regularly to maintain their interest.
  • Offer plenty of opportunities for activity. A tired pet is a well-behaved pet.

Remember, creating a pet-friendly home is an ongoing process. Regularly assess your home environment and implement changes as needed to ensure your furry buddie lives a happy and secure life.
